#e4fc59 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e4fc59 is composed of 89.4% red, 98.8%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 9.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 64.7% yellow and 1.2% black. It has a hue angle of 68.8 degrees, a saturation of 96.4% and a lightness of 66.9%. #e4fc59 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ffb2 with #c9f900. Closest websafe color is: #ccff66.

Shades and Tints of #e4fc59
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060700 is the darkest color, while #fdfff3 is the lightest one.
